Title:
PCR MODULE

Abstract:
Disclosed is a PCR module in which a sample can be injected using the capillary effect. The PCR module comprises: a microfluidic chamber which includes an inlet part for inputting a sample and is manufactured by injection molding; a well array which is disposed on the lower surface of the microfluidic chamber and includes a plurality of micro-wells of which the upper and lower portions are perforated; and a capillary member providing a path so that the sample input through the inlet part reaches the micro-wells through the capillary effect. When moving a PCR solution to a reaction space using the capillary effect and filling the reaction space with the solution, it is possible to prevent air pockets from forming in the corners or edge regions of the well array which is the reaction space. Accordingly, it is possible to prevent errors caused by air pockets from occurring in PCR test results. In addition, since the well array is located on a CMOS photosensor array, PCR reactions can be measured in real time.
